Responsibilities

  • Maintain office supplies, pantry inventory, and workplace amenities
  • Coordinate relationships with vendors, service providers, building management, and maintenance teams.
  • Manage office-related invoices, ensuring timely submission and tracking for payment.
  • Welcome and assist visitors, guests, and external partners
  • Own and maintain the daily studio calendar, coordinating meetings, shoots, events, and internal activities across teams.
  • Support leadership and department heads with meeting coordination and logistical planning across the daily office itinerary.
  • Partner with leadership and HR on onboarding logistics for new hires (workspace setup, welcome coordination, first-day preparations) and other special projects that support a positive workplace experience.

Requirements

  • 1 to 3 years of experience in office management, workplace operations, studio coordination, or a similar administrative role, ideally within a media, creative agency, or lifestyle brand environment.
  • Strong organisational and multitasking abilities, with the ability to juggle competing priorities in a fast-paced studio environment.
  • Comfort using standard workplace tools such as Google Workspace, Slack, and calendar management platforms, and other tools specific to the teams and region.
  • Proactive, solutions-oriented mindset with a demonstrated ability to anticipate needs before they arise.
  • Candidate must be eligible to work in the US.

Nice to have

  • Bachelor's degree in human resources, administration or other related fields is preferred.
  • previous experience supporting content production, photo/video shoots, or studio operations is a plus.
  • Passion for contemporary culture, streetwear, or the creative industries

Company info

  • Hypebeast is a leading global platform for contemporary culture and lifestyle, and a premier destination for editorially-driven news and commerce.
  • Founded in 2005, it became a publicly listed company in 2016, and today boasts a global readership across North America, Asia Pacific, Europe and more.
  • The Group has expanded its publishing brands to a wider scope, encompassing Hypebeast and its multiple content distribution platforms, creative agency Hypemaker, and e-commerce and retail platform HBX.
